The Marmac 306, a specialized cable-laying barge, has sparked curiosity and speculation in Rhode Island. Docked in Providence for months, it's the first American-made vessel of its kind, designed to lay underwater power cables for offshore wind farms. The barge's presence is significant as it aligns with the Jones Act, a law promoting domestic shipbuilding. However, the purpose of its deployment remains unclear, with conflicting statements from city officials and the developer of the SouthCoast Wind project.
City officials claim the barge is linked to the long-stalled SouthCoast Wind project, a 141-turbine farm planned for waters south of Nantucket. This project, however, faces challenges due to federal approval delays, influenced by the Trump administration's stance against wind power. The developer, Ocean Winds North America, denies the barge's involvement, suggesting it may be working on a different, active project.
Marmac 306's unique appearance, equipped with advanced cable-laying technology, has led to various speculations. Its specialized machinery, including a multiple-anchor positioning system and a vertical injector shaft, sets it apart from conventional vessels. The barge's role in laying cables for the Empire Wind farm off the coast of New York further adds to the mystery.
The barge's American-made status is a key factor in its significance. By complying with the Jones Act, it supports the domestic shipbuilding industry and enhances national, economic, and homeland security. The Seafarers International Union praised the barge's launch, emphasizing its potential to create jobs and reinforce the Jones Act's importance.
